Why Might You Need a Local Locksmith for Your Car?
Car locksmith professionals are specialized experts trained to handle a variety of automotive lock and key concerns. Here are some typical circumstances where their services are essential:

Car Lockouts: This is the most common factor to call a vehicle locksmith. If you've mistakenly locked your keys inside your car or lost them entirely, a locksmith can help you get access without triggering damage.

Lost or Stolen Keys: Losing your car keys or having them stolen is stressful, but a replacement key can be easily crafted by a skilled locksmith.

Broken Keys: Over time, car keys can wear out, and in many cases, they may even break inside your car's lock or ignition. A locksmith can safely extract the broken key and replace it.

Faulty Car Locks: Locks can end up being jammed or fail due to rust, wear, or damage. A locksmith can repair or replace harmed locks on doors or trunks.

Transponder Key Programming: Modern cars and trucks frequently use transponder keys with embedded microchips for added security. A locksmith with the right tools can program these keys to sync with your vehicle.

Key Fob Issues: If your car's key fob quits working, locksmith professionals can either repair the existing remote or provide you with a brand-new one.

1. How much does it cost to employ a local car locksmith?The expense varies
depending upon the service you need. For instance, a basic car lockout service may cost ₤ 50-- ₤ 150, while key replacement or programming can be ₤ 100-- ₤ 300, depending upon the complexity.

2. Can a locksmith make a replacement key without the original?Yes, an expert locksmith can produce a replacement key even if you don't have the initial. They can use your car's VIN(Vehicle Identification Number)or special key codes for this purpose. 3. Will a locksmith damage my car during service?No, a

trustworthy locksmith utilizes specialized tools and methods to avoid damaging your vehicle while acquiring gain access to or repairing the locking system. 4. The length of time does it take for a locksmith to unlock a car?In most cases, opening a car

takes anywhere from 5 to 30 minutes, depending upon the kind of lock
and car design. 5. Do locksmith professionals deal with key fob programming?Yes, lots of locksmiths are geared up to program key fobs and transponder keys
, frequently at a much lower cost than a dealership. 6. What need to I do if my key breaks in the ignition?Turn off the car locksmith near me prices and prevent attempting to extract the key yourself, as this could cause more damage.

Call a locksmith immediately-- they have the tools to remove the broken piece without damaging the ignition.
